NewsletterGuanxi is a prerequisite for doing business in China, as Berkshire Publishing Group has learned through its own ventures. Now Berkshire offers you Guanxi: The China Letter, a network of China hands--analysts, journalists, and China watchers, as well as scholars and successful business people--who will help you negotiate, and navigate the fascinating world of modern-day China.

During good times and bad, the Chinese have depended on guanxi--literally “networks of mutual support”--for help in negotiating government bureaucracies. Today, guanxi is coming to have a larger meaning as China becomes a growing influence in the global community and as its peoples global connections, online and off, develop in myriad ways. In Guanxi: The China Letter, we look at guanxi as a vital form of social networking that can inform and improve business activities and make those who have it, whether individuals or companies, the preferred partners for Chinese companies, too.
